The Position of Density in Conversions
Density is outlined because the mass of a substance per unit quantity, usually measured in grams per milliliter (g/mL). As an illustration, the density of water is roughly 1 g/mL, which signifies that 1 milliliter of water weighs 1 gram. Nonetheless, not all substances have a density of 1 g/mL. The density of a substance impacts the connection between milliliters and grams, and it is important to think about this property when changing between these models.
Density = mass / quantity

Widespread Errors in Changing Milliliters to Grams
Some of the important challenges in changing milliliters to grams is the lack of understanding in regards to the density of various substances. As an illustration, water has a density of roughly 1 gram per milliliter, whereas honey has a density of round 1.4 grams per milliliter. Which means that 100 milliliters of honey would weigh greater than 100 milliliters of water.
- Failure to think about the density of the substance: That is the most typical mistake, resulting in incorrect conversions and subsequent penalties.
- Inaccurate measurement of quantity: Measuring the incorrect quantity can lead to incorrect conversions, even when the density is appropriate.
- Misunderstanding of unit conversions: Failing to grasp the connection between milliliters and grams can result in errors.
